Overview

Postcode PR2 2SA is located in an urban city, within the Ashton ward of Preston in the North West region, and forms part of the Ashton-on-Ribble & Larches area. It has very high deprivation and very high crime levels, with around 153.9 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income of residents in Ashton-on-Ribble & Larches is £38,700 per year. The nearest station is Preston (Lancs) located about 1.0 miles away. There are 6 primary and 2 secondary schools in the area.
